Web9 mrt. 2024 · The parameter p’ map was produced for each lesion included in the datasets, and its values were determined by the images collected while the corresponding skin area was illuminated sequentially with four wavelengths: 405 nm to induce skin autofluorescence, 526 nm to retrieve the blood absorption, 663 nm for melanin absorption evaluation, … WebThere is a unique optical window between 650 and 950 nm where visible and near-infrared (NIR) light can be used to image the brain. 4 Light with a wavelength lower than 650 nm is strongly absorbed by hemoglobin, whereas light with a wavelength higher than 950 nm is mainly absorbed by water. When NIR light is passed though a tissue, it can be absorbed, …
